UGX 320S is a 1977 Triumph Stag in Blue with a 2,997c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.2%.
Across all 1977 Triumph Stag models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.7% with a typical mileage of 60,708 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Triumph Stag fails its MOT is windscreen washer provides insufficient washer liquid, accounting for 2,039 recorded failures. If you're considering buying UGX 320S,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Triumph Stag typically stays on UK roads for around 56 years. At 49 years old, this Triumph Stag is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
